to wit: http://slate.msn.com/id/2082361/ there is a lot wrong with this article, but one paragraph really gets my goat: "When weighed against his I.D.M. peers??-Ziq, Squarepusher, Autechre?James' flexibility seems almost perverse. They are known for being one-trick ponies, albeit ones with mighty cool tricks. Limited to the software on their laptops, they're not expected to be any more adaptable than a classical violinist, an inveterate punk, or a hazy prog rocker. Aphex Twin, though, has made music that could satisfy all those constituencies and more. Classical music? Check. Pop songs? Check. Ambient works? Check. Dance hits? Yup. Occasionally he's even played the roll of celebrity remixer. Hence his new record, 26 Remixes for Cash." One trick ponies? are you kidding? who the hell thinks that? squarepusher: manic drill & bass? check. free jazz workouts? check. nutty 2-step? check autechre: if you played incunabula and then draft 7.30 for the "man on the street" do you really think said man would say that they sound like the same artist? and i can't even keep track of how many alias's u-ziq has used. what a bunch of crap. ok, rant over. dave --------------------------------- Do you Yahoo!?
